Job Title: Shift Engineer

Salary: £45,000 to £47,000 DOE

Location: Leighton Buzzard Pension, Life Assurance, 25 days holiday & Healthcare

Hours: 6pm to 2pm or 10pm to 6am

We have a great opportunity to join a worldwide business as a Shift Engineer for a production facility based in Leighton Buzzard.

The Shift Engineer would be responsible for supporting the production team with a proactive service to enable production lines to run safely and efficiently, reduce downtime through Planned Preventative Maintenance (PPM) and continuous improvements all while having a high regard for Health and Safety.

Key responsibilities for a Shift Engineer

Engineering maintenance and fault finding on industrial machinery

Onsite maintenance and engineerings support for site assets

Working on PPM schedules

Troubleshooting systems


Essential skills for a Shift Engineer

Rounded engineer with an electrical/mechanical bias

Experience of working in a manufacturing facility

Knowledge and experience of injection moulding industry

Computer literate

Compliant with Health and Safety requirements

Self-motivated and able to work independently on maintenance tasks


Benefits for a Shift Engineer

25 days of Annual leave + bank holidays

Weekly attendance bonus

Generous pension scheme

Private healthcare
